Synthetic rubber is a man-made material that functions like natural rubber. Synthetic rubber is made with petroleum, which gives it multiple advantages over natural rubber.
Rubber plastic or synthetic rubber was first produced in 1879 by Bouchardat of France. One of the most important items made from synthetic rubber is tires.
